摘 要:目的 探讨血清维生素A、D水平与新生儿感染的严重程度及预后之间的关系。方法 收集2020年4月至2022年4月苏州大学附属儿童医院新生儿科住院的82例新生儿感染性疾病患儿为观察组;根据新生儿危重病例评分将其分为极危重组(20例)、危重组(25例)、非危重组(37例);根据预后情况,将其分为死亡组(11例)和生存组(71例)。选取同期住院非感染新生儿80例作为对照组。比较观察组与对照组血清维生素A、D水平;比较新生儿感染不同疾病重症程度患儿血清维生素A、D水平;分析血清维生素A、D水平与新生儿感染疾病重症程度的相关性;分析新生儿感染患儿预后的影响因素;评估血清维生素A、D对新生感染患儿预后的预测价值。结果 观察组维生素A、D水平低于对照组(P<0.05)。极危重组、危重组血清维生素A、D水平低于非危重组,极危重组血清维生素A、D水平低于危重组(P<0.05)。血清维生素A、D水平与新生儿感染疾病危重程度呈负相关(r=-0.458、-0.489,P<0.01)。死亡组降钙素原(PCT)、C反应蛋白(CRP)水平高于生存组,维生素A、D水平低于生存组(P<0.05)。PCT、CRP、维生素A、维生素D是新生儿感染预后的影响因素(P<0.05)。维生素A、D联合预测新生感染预后的曲线下面积高于各项单独预测。结论 新生儿感染时血清维生素A、D水平与疾病严重及预后密切相关,并可以作为预测预后的有效指标。Objective To investigate the relationship between serum vitamin A and D levels and the severity and prognosis of neonatal infection.Methods From April 2020 to April 2022,82 children with neonatal infection hospitalized in Department of Neonatology,Children's Hospital of Soochow University were collected as observation group;they were divided into extremely critical group(20 cases),critical group(25 cases),and non-critical group(37 cases) according to neonatal critical illness;according to the prognosis,they were divided into death group(11 cases) and survival group(71 cases).A total of 80 hospitalized non-infected neonates with different were selected as control group.Serum vitamin A and D levels were compared between observation group and control group;serum vitamin A and D levels in children with neonatal infection neonates with different disease severity were compared.The correlation between serum vitamin A and D levels and different disease severity of children with neonatal infection disease was analyzed;the factors influencing prognosis of children with neonatal infection was analyzed;and the predictive value of serum vitamin A and D in prognosis of children with neonatal infection was evaluated.Results Serum vitamin A and D levels in observation group were lower than those in control group(P<0.05).Serum vitamin A and D levels in extremely critical group and critical group were lower than those in non-critical group,and serum vitamin A and D levels in extremely critical group were lower than those in critical group(P<0.05).Serum vitamin A and D levels were negatively correlated with different disease severity of children with neonatal infection disease(r=-0.458,-0.489,P <0.01).procalcitonin(PCT) and C-reactive protein(CRP) levels in death group were higher than those in survival group,while vitamin A and D levels were lower than those in survival group(P<0.05).PCT,CRP,vitamin A,and vitamin D were the influencing factors of prognosis of children with neonatal infection(P<0.05).The area under the curve of vit
